Michelle Trachtenbergis being remembered for a very special career.
Fans are reeling following the news that the actress, best known for her roles asGeorgina Sparks onGossip GirlandDawn Summers onBuffy the Vampire Slayer, among others, hasdied at the age of 39.
As fans mourn her loss, they are looking back at how the actress grew from her early days of child stardom to her most recent roles.

At 9 years old, Trachtenberg did a three-episode stint, originating the role of Lily Montgomery onAll My Children. Lily, who lived with autism, was the stepdaughter of Jackson Montgomery and daughter of Laurel Bannon.

The Adventures of Pete & Petesaw Trachtenberg playing Iggy Pop’s daughter, Nona Mecklenberg. She started out as just a neighbor but quickly became Little Pete’s best friend. She wore a cast all the time just to make her arm itchy.

In 2000, Trachtenberg joined the cast ofBuffy the Vampire Slayeras Dawn Summers. Buffy’s little sister. She had a big impact on the show’s action, introduced as if she was always there when her appearance in the show’s timeline actually became significant in later seasons. After some tenuous adolescent years, the character grew to find her strength.

In Disney’sIce Princess, Trachtenberg played Casey Carlyle, a smart girl who has always been focused on schoolwork but takes a chance on her love of skating and finds out she could be great. With a different vision for her future than her mom, Casey was forced to figure out what she wants and what’s best for her life.

In this 1974 slasher film remake, Trachtenberg played Michelle, one of several sorority sisters trying to dodge a murderer on Christmas Day 2006.

Trachtenberg played Maggie, the daughter of Mike and Scarlet, in17 Again. She was born to the pair as teen parents, derailing plans the two had for the future. Fast-forward to her own teen years and she’s dating a guy her dad can’t stand who torments her little brother, until a series of changes has her looking at life differently.

InTake Me Home Tonight, Trachtenberg had a bit part as Ashley. The goth girl took notice of character Barry at a party and gave him some advice that went against the grain, giving him new perspective.
